# Models
This is an example of a **Typus** enabled model with all available options. You
can use this example to customize your YAML files which only have set the most
common settings.
Post:
fields:
default: id, title, category_id, created_at, is_published?
list: id, title, category_id, created_at, is_published?
form: title, body, is_published?, created_at
show: title, category, is_published?
relationship: title, status
options:
auto_generated:
booleans:
is_published: ["Yes, it is", "No, it isn't"]
date_formats:
created_at: post_long
selectors:
read_only:
filter_by_date_range: valid_until
templates:
body: rich_text
actions:
index: cleanup
edit: send_as_newsletter
show: rebuild
export: csv, xml
order_by: created_at
relationships:
filters: is_published?, created_at, category_id
search: title, body
application: Application
description: Some text to describe the model
options:
action_after_save: :index
default_action_on_item: show
end_year: 2015
form_rows: 25
minute_step: 15
nil: 'nil'
only_user_items: true
per_page: 5
start_year: 1990
Note: To define namespace models use :: as a separator. (i.e. Delayed::Job)
# Roles
In this file you can configure the actions available for each of your models on
the application. You can also use the 'all' shortcut to allow the user the
access to all actions.
admin:
Post: create, read, update, delete
Category: create, read, update, delete
TypusUser: all
editor:
Post: create, read, update
Category: read, update
You can also define `resources` which are not related to a model, for example
to control `Redis`.
admin:
Redis: index, flush_all
